Free Money Finance:   Big Difference Between Average and Median Net Worths - FMF make a great point about Average vs Median Net Worths.  Big Whales like Mr Buffett and Mr. Gates skews the Average number to such a degree that it’s no longer a good representation of the real average middle class folks.
